I am giving some thought to buying a refurbished Uniden HomePatrol HP-1. I am just wondering what the biggest risk is? I suspect most have a 90 day warranty rather than a full 1 year warranty. What other considerations are there for buying a refurbished Uniden HP-1?
My biggest concern, after the the length of the warranty period, as well as return options (if any), would be 'who did the refurb?' My definition of a refurbished product would be one that may have had some sort of defect reported. That problem was addressed and corrected, and the unit was working correctly now. The seller's view may be different. They simply cleaned it up, reloaded firmware, it seems to turn on, so they label it "refurbished" Credibility of the seller would be key to me. I'd also want to verify it came with
all the original accessories (ac & dc adapter, usb cable, antenna, the 'mini=stand', etc).
I would not be uncomfortable buying a "like new" unit direct from
Uniden. "Like new" is defined on the site as usually retail store returns, units that had damaged boxes. or missing components or accessories. These are inspected, tested, and refurbed as needed before being sold with a 90-day warranty. However, at the current cost of $429, that's not far from the lower range of where some new units have been found recently.
